[490] "Do not lament so grievously, Sāma, fair to behold;
having become a servant, I shall support them for you in the great forest.
And I am skilled in the archer's art, renowned as one of firm bow;
having become a servant, I shall support them for you in the great forest.
Searching out the leavings of the wild beasts, and the roots and fruits of the forest,
having become a servant, I shall support them for you in the great forest.
Which is that forest, Sāma, where your mother and father dwell?
I shall support them just as you yourself have supported them."
